The Theological Foundation of Defiance College Defiance College operates within the rich and pluralistic tradition of the United Church of Christ (UCC). Historically rooted in the Congregationalist movement, the institution reflects a theological heritage that emphasizes the freedom of the individual conscience and the importance of a learned clergy and laity. In the UCC tradition, faith is not a static set of dogmas but a living, evolving dialogue between ancient scripture and the modern world. This perspective informs every aspect of life at Defiance College, creating an environment where students are encouraged to ask difficult questions and seek truth in both the spiritual and secular realms. The UCC motto, "That they may all be one," serves as a guiding principle for the college's approach to community and inclusivity. This ecumenical spirit allows Defiance to welcome students from diverse religious and non religious backgrounds while maintaining a firm identity as a Christian institution. The theological framework here is one of covenant, where the community agrees to walk together in a spirit of mutual respect and service. The institution defines itself through an educational philosophy that integrates classroom theory with real world application. This is not merely a pedagogical choice but a theological one, reflecting the UCC commitment to being the hands and feet of Christ in a broken world. The McMaster School for Advancing Humanity is the jewel of this approach, providing students with opportunities to engage in community based research and service both locally and internationally. This model of education shapes the student experience by: - Encouraging students to identify and solve systemic problems in underserved populations. - Integrating multidisciplinary perspectives to address complex social issues such as poverty and health care access. - Fostering a sense of global citizenship that aligns with the Christian call to love one's neighbor. - Developing leadership skills through hands on project management and cross cultural collaboration. By embedding service into the curriculum, Defiance College ensures that its graduates are not only competent professionals but also empathetic leaders. It is a space where the values of the United Church of Christ are lived out in daily interactions. The college provides numerous avenues for spiritual growth, including campus ministry, small group studies, and regular worship services. However, in keeping with the UCC tradition, participation is never coerced. Instead, students are invited into a community that values their presence and their unique contributions. Athletics also play a significant role in the Defiance experience. As a member of the NCAA Division III, the college emphasizes the "student" in student athlete. The discipline, teamwork, and persistence required on the field are seen as complementary to the academic and spiritual formation occurring in other areas of campus life. Defiance College is church related and affiliated with the United Church of Christ, a denomination with roots in the Congregationalist and Christian traditions. The college maintains an open and inclusive environment that welcomes students of all faiths and backgrounds while remaining grounded in its UCC heritage. Q: How does Defiance College integrate service into its curriculum? Service is integrated primarily through the McMaster School for Advancing Humanity, which allows students to participate in community based research and international service projects. This approach ensures that students apply their academic knowledge to solve real world problems and develop a lifelong commitment to civic engagement. Q: What are the primary academic strengths of Defiance College? Defiance College is well known for its professional programs in education, social work, criminal justice, and business, all of which are grounded in a strong liberal arts foundation. The college emphasizes small class sizes, individualized attention from faculty, and a curriculum that focuses on ethical leadership and social responsibility. Q: Does Defiance College offer graduate programs? Yes, Defiance College offers graduate degrees in fields such as business administration and education.
